# Changelog

## 0.5.23

### Enhancements

- Add `--refresh` to `uv venv` ([#10834](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10834))
- Add `--no-default-groups` command-line flag ([#10618](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10618))

### Bug fixes

- Sort extras and groups when comparing lockfile requirements ([#10856](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10856))
- Include `commit_id` and `requested_revision` in `direct_url.json` ([#10862](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10862))
- Invalidate lockfile when static versions change ([#10858](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10858))
- Make GitHub fast path errors non-fatal ([#10859](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10859))
- Remove warnings for `--frozen` and `--locked` in `uv run --script` ([#10840](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10840))
- Resolve `find-links` paths relative to the configuration file ([#10827](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10827))
- Respect visitation order for proxy packages ([#10833](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10833))
- Treat version mismatch errors as non-fatal in fast paths ([#10860](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10860))
- Mark `--locked` and `--upgrade` are conflicting ([#10836](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10836))
- Relax error checking around unconditional enabling of conflicting extras ([#10875](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10875))

### Documentation

- Reduce ambiguity in conflicting extras example ([#10877](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10877))
- Update pre-commit documentation ([#10756](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10756))

### Error messages

- Error when workspace contains conflicting Python requirements ([#10841](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/10841))
- Improve uvx error message when uv is missing ([#9745](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v/pull/9745))
